Project Overview:

Join us as we make history at the Hanford Vit Plant, known as the Waste Treatment and Immobilization Plant. We are designing and building a one-of-a-kind facility that will turn radioactive and chemical waste left over from World War II and Cold War plutonium production into a form safe for disposal. Your efforts will help protect the nearby Columbia River and the communities, salmon, and wildlife along its shorelines throughout the Northwest.

Job Summary:

The External Assessments Manager will report to the Independent Assessment Manager in the Quality Assurance Organization and will support the maintenance, development, and implementation of the WTP Quality Assurance program. #LI-SB1

Major Responsibilities:

  • Provides supervision and training to personnel performing assessment activities and ensures that issues are properly controlled and documented in accordance with project procedures.
  • Provides direction and assigns, reviews and checks work to assigned oversight personnel and others who assist on specific assignments to ensure technical and quality requirements, management goals and objectives are met.
  • Provides input into the development of standardized metrics and responds to engineering, construction, procurement, and others who request guidance on implementation of quality requirements.
  • ·Actively promotes and facilitates a proactive line self-identification of issues, timeliness of action planning and closure, management ownership of actions and the implementation effectiveness of actions taken as demonstrated by non-repetitive issues, and organizational ability to learn.
  • Analyzes, identifies actions and recommends solutions to mitigate performance risk.
  • Prepares QA procedures and guides for approval in accordance with the governing procedures.
  • Reviews and reports on new or revised regulatory requirements and their impact on the established QA program.
  • Monitors project engineering, nuclear safety, environmental, procurement, construction, testing, operations, and other activities to evaluate the quality of products, activities, and program effectiveness.
  • Prepares and completes quality audit checklists and participates in quality audits of corporate/project quality program/plans including, as needed, pre-award assessments of potential suppliers and subcontractors as a qualified lead auditor and supervisor.
  • As an Audit Team Lead (ATL), prepare, plan, and perform audits/assessments.
